KEYNOTE SPEAKER
Adetomiwa Emmanuel Adesokan
University of Nevada, Reno USA
Topic : Nexus Between Carbon Emissions and Economic Growth in Nigeria
Adetomiwa Emmanuel Adesokan is a PhD student in Economics at the University of Nevada, Reno USA. His work explores environmental economics, macroeconomic issues, and the growing role of cybersecurity and artificial intelligence in modern economies. He completed his MSc in Economics at the University of Ibadan and his BSc in Economics at the Federal University of Agriculture, Abeokuta. Adetomiwa has taught at Dominican University and served as a graduate assistant in both Nigeria and the United States. He combines research with teaching, professional service, and community mentorship, reflecting his commitment to scholarship that addresses real-world economic and social challenges.
